Mannu di Gali
Mannu di Gali is a pass in Abbottabad District,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a and has an elevation of 1,533 metres. Mannu di Gali is situated nearby to the locality Manu di Gali, as well as near Salhad Tarli.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Abbottabad and Nawan Shehr.
Abbottabad

Abbottabad is a city in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a of Pakistan, north of Islamabad on the Karakoram Highway. The town is at an altitude of 1250 m and gets quite a lot of Pakistani tourism, mainly people escaping the hot season in nearby Islamabad, Rawalpindi or Peshawar.
Nawan Shehr
Town
Nawan Shehr is a town in Abbottabad District, Khyber Pakthunkhwa, Pakistan. The town is renowned for the historic Ilyasi Masjid, the largest and oldest mosque in the district of Abbottabad. Nawan Shehr is situated 6 km northeast of Mannu di Gali.
